The Impact of Sleep on Mental and Physical Endurance

Sleep plays a critical role in our overall performance, both mentally and physically. It is during sleep that the body undergoes essential processes, contributing to recovery and rejuvenation. For athletes and fitness enthusiasts, adequate sleep is not just a luxury but a necessity. Sleep deprivation can lead to a decline in cognitive function, decision-making, and reaction times, all of which are vital in sports and high-pressure situations. Moreover, sleep affects mood and motivation, which are crucial for maintaining a consistent training regimen. Research indicates that individuals who prioritize sleep often report feeling more focused and energized in their training. To optimize endurance levels, individuals should aim for 7 to 9 hours of quality sleep per night. Certain practices, like maintaining a consistent sleep schedule and creating a relaxing bedtime routine, can enhance sleep quality. As part of an effective training program, integrating good sleep habits can offer substantial benefits in endurance performance, providing an edge over less-rested competitors. Prioritizing sleep can also help prevent injuries, ensuring that the body has ample time to recover from strenuous exercise.

Adequate sleep not only impacts physical performance but has profound effects on mental endurance as well. Fatigue can diminish cognitive processes, such as memory, attention, and problem-solving capabilities. Athletes often rely on their mental sharpness to execute strategies and adjust techniques during performances. Insufficient sleep can lead to increased levels of stress hormones, which may further impact mental clarity and emotional control. Additionally, when training intensifies, managing mental fatigue becomes just as important as addressing physical exhaustion. Quality sleep improves mood stability and resilience, essential traits needed for lasting endurance in both competition and training sessions. Engaging in practices to enhance sleep quality, like meditation or light stretching before bed, can help calm the mind, leading to improved emotional and cognitive functioning. Furthermore, using strategies such as limiting screen time before sleep and ensuring a comfortable sleeping environment may contribute positively to mental endurance. Sleep Quality and Performance Shifts

Sleep quality directly correlates with performance levels in endurance activities. Disruptions in sleep can alter the body’s physiological responses, affecting heart rate, respiration, and overall stamina. Studies indicate that a consistent sleeping pattern enhances an athlete’s adaptability during endurance exercises. Regular sleep disturbances can contribute to increased fatigue, making it difficult to pursue daily training goals. The restorative functions of sleep allow the body to repair damaged tissues and replenish energy stores utilized during strenuous activities. Furthermore, post-exercise sleep plays an influential role in enabling muscle recovery. Engaging in comprehensive sleep strategies promotes better performance on athletic benchmarks. Strategies to improve sleep hygiene are vital for enhancing sleep quality, ultimately benefiting endurance training. Creating a conducive sleeping environment is crucial for achieving deep, restorative sleep. Dark, quiet rooms with comfortable bedding can significantly improve sleep depth. Establishing a pre-sleep routine can signal the body to wind down properly. Simple changes, such as reducing caffeine intake and establishing a regular sleep schedule, can yield remarkable results. Additionally, athletes might consider implementing relaxation techniques, such as deep breathing or guided imagery, to facilitate falling asleep more effortlessly. Avoiding stimulating activities right before bed reinforces better sleep hygiene. Assessing sleep quality regularly helps identify trends and alter any detrimental habits. Techniques like journaling thoughts or planning for the next day can help clear the mind before bedtime. Sleep consistency also reinforces the body’s internal clock, assisting in falling asleep and waking up at desired times. Sleep debt accumulates over time when athletes fail to prioritize adequate rest, leading to declining performance. Understanding this accumulation is crucial for maintaining optimal endurance levels. A consistent lack of sleep can have compounding effects on the body, resulting in difficulty managing fatigue. Recommendations suggest tracking sleep hours and setting realistic sleep goals as part of endurance training planning. Additionally, power naps may serve an advantageous role, helping to reduce the sleep debt. Studies reveal that short naps can enhance overall performance, especially in subsequent training sessions. This adjustment can provide immediate boosts in focus and vitality, allowing athletes to push through intense workouts. Athletes should consider timing these naps strategically, ensuring they do not interfere with nighttime sleep schedules.
